Compile yourself sources, like that you could even edit sources (in future), add/remove anything you want and keep your copy up to date. Precompiled shouldn't be used because it's static revisions (often older), and you don't know if the guy who made the compilation made it clean or made errors (or added stuff on it). L2J wiki got all infos you need to compile & install.
